    Greetings, I have a Curve 8530 and I was wondering does any one have problems with theirs staying connected with their home WIFI network. Mines shows that it is connected but the WIFI icon will be highlighted for a few mins and it shadows out and it's at that time that the connection does not work despite showing it is connected to my network which is indicated by my network name at the very top of the screen. Any infomation out there?

    Had a similar problem on the 8520 which would last through battery pulls, ctrl-shift-dels, even to the extent of an OS upgrade (from stock to .348)!

    Anyways solution for me turned out to be simply restarting my wifi router - an old Belkin.

    DO try restarting your router and let us know what happens.
